3 Progress Na Pr Tica
Migrando V8/V9 para OpenEdge® 10
Regis Martins Ezipato
Pre Sales Manager
O que há de novo no RDBMS?
Performance
• Type II Storage Areas
Visibilidade
• Log File
• Fast Drop & Temp tables
• Increased shmem –B 1 billion
• Internal algorithmic enhancements
• Buffers, Locks, Indexing
• Improved APW scanning
• Auto Record Defrag
• Enhanced Txn Backout
• New Defaults
Suporte a Tipo de Dados
• BLOB, CLOB
• Datetime, Datetime-TZ
• INT64 (no conversion)
2
OPS-10: Moving V8/V9 RDBMS to OpenEdge 10
• New format
• Significant events
• Improved management
• Db I/O by User by Object
• Database Describe
Suporte a Grandes Bases
• 64 bit Rowids
• 64 bit Sequences
• 64 bit Integer Datatype
• Large Index Key Entries (1970)
• 32,000 areas
• 8 TB Shmem
© 2008 Progress Software Corporation
O que há de novo no RDBMS?
Alta Disponibilidade
• Online Schema adds
• Sequences
• Tables
• Fields
• Indexes w/fast fill
• Online space management
• Enabled/Disable AI online
• Enable AI Mgmt online
• HA Clusters Bundled
Manutenção
• Index Rebuild
• By area, table, active status
•.st file syntax checker
• AI Management
• Multi threaded utilities
• idxbuild, binary dump
• Binary Dump without index
• Binary Load Performance
• Index Fix with NO-LOCK
Segurança
• SSL
• Auditing
3
OPS-10: Moving V8/V9 RDBMS to OpenEdge 10
© 2008 Progress Software Corporation
Agenda
Estratégia Geral de Migração
Upgrade rápido e fácil
Upgrade Físico
Oportunidade de Tuning
4
OPS-10: Moving V8/V9 RDBMS to OpenEdge 10
© 2008 Progress Software Corporation
Passos Básicos
Primeiro detalhe o planejamento, revise, teste e ENTÃO execute
Preparação
• BI truncado, Desabilitar AI, 2PC, e Replication (V9)
• Backup (V8/9)
Instalação
• Instalar OpenEdge
• Não precisa desintalar V8/9
• *Não sobrescrever seu diretório Progress
Upgrade
• Upgrade DB para OpenEdge 10
• Faça backups !!!!
• Recompile/Redistribua seu código ABL se o cliente é
OpenEdge
Execute a aplicação e teste,